OTUB2/NR4A1 restrains the development of preeclampsia by suppressing macrophage M1 polarization


ABSTRACT: Preeclampsia is one of the most common pregnancy disorders, and characterized by insufficient trophoblast invasion and placental inflammation. RNA sequencing was performed using placental tissues collected from PE patients and control healthy pregnant women. The results showed that OTU deubiquitinase, ubiquitin aldehyde binding 2 (OTUB2) was downregulated in placenta from PE patients.
